Output e5d36ae2a33f185394e323b9c28d4c4c4cd0ca4cd17c2aed1af396f62ec2781a:0

value
58303884
script pubkey
OP_0 OP_PUSHBYTES_20 d507e79f779145bd1b6a454b48ba821a1a19fcef
address
bc1q65r708mhj9zm6xm2g4953w5zrgdpnl80myadl8
transaction
e5d36ae2a33f185394e323b9c28d4c4c4cd0ca4cd17c2aed1af396f62ec2781a